Understanding the Allen Bradley 1769-IA16

The Allen Bradley 1769-IA16 is a Compact I/O AC digital input module designed for use with CompactLogix and MicroLogix control systems. It provides sixteen AC input channels that allow programmable controllers to monitor the status of field devices such as push buttons, selector switches, proximity sensors, limit switches, and other AC-operated input equipment.

In modern manufacturing environments, reliable signal acquisition is essential for maintaining production efficiency and minimizing downtime. The 1769-IA16 serves as a critical interface between field devices and the controller, ensuring that operational data is captured accurately and processed in real time.

Industries such as automotive manufacturing, food processing, packaging, material handling, water treatment, and energy production frequently deploy this module because of its stability and compatibility within CompactLogix architectures.

Technical Specifications

Parameter Description
Module Type AC Digital Input Module
Input Channels 16 Channels
Product Family Compact I/O Series
Controller Compatibility CompactLogix and MicroLogix Systems
Diagnostic Indicators Integrated Channel Status LEDs
Installation Method DIN Rail or Panel Mounting

These specifications make the module suitable for a wide range of automation projects requiring dependable AC input monitoring.

Troubleshooting Common Issues

Even highly reliable modules may occasionally require diagnostics. The following table outlines common problems and recommended actions.

Issue Possible Cause Suggested Solution
No Input Response Incorrect wiring Inspect wiring connections
Intermittent Signals Electrical noise Improve shielding and grounding
Module Fault Power or hardware issue Verify power supply and replace if necessary
Communication Problems Configuration mismatch Review controller configuration

A structured troubleshooting approach can reduce downtime and accelerate maintenance activities.
